Samuel Sjayakanthan

Vandstrom

Research Director

Samuel Jayakanthan leads the Protein Sciences team at Vandstrom, a company revolutionizing water desalination by harnessing the unique filtration properties of proteins. With a background that spans biophysics, structural biology, and protein engineering, he seeks to leverage innovative technologies to help solve the world’s environmental crises and push humanity forward. He is passionate about integral membrane proteins and how harnessing their unrivaled capabilities can help solve some of the world’s toughest challenges, from water scarcity to the recovery of rare earth elements and critical minerals.‍

From Cells to Patients: Solving the Scale Mismatch in Virtual Biology

Drug discovery often measures biology at the cell level while interventions work at the tissue, organ, or whole-patient scale. This mismatch can make accurate cell-level predictions irrelevant in the clinic. This session dives into strategies to bridge that gap: multiscale modeling that nests single-cell dynamics within organ-level simulations, spatial transcriptomics that preserve context, and surrogate models that translate cell-level outputs into clinical biomarkers. Speakers will ask: how do we ensure virtual biology reflects not just what cells do in isolation, but how biology behaves in the real complexity of patients?
